Paperback. Condition: New. Print on Demand. The author brings together diverse thinkers to present a fresh outlook on science and its critical role in improving human life. Issues analyzed include increasing scientific innovation in industrial and agricultural processes, and the impact on global competition and resources. The author argues for lifelong learning, the integration of the humanities and sciences in education, and citizens informed of scientific advance. While acknowledging that we cannot simply turn away from industrial life in favor of a rural existence, the author believes science can lead us to a better, more healthful way of living. The book's insights are essential to understanding the increasing importance of science, and organizing our physical and social lives for an uncertain future. Paperback. Condition: New. Print on Demand. This book is a compilation of essays by various authors who seek to inspire readers to take up their role of citizenship with the utmost seriousness. The main focus is on ethics and responsibilities, and how these should underpin all our political, economic, and social interactions. The authors contend that only by becoming informed about our society, from local to national level, can individuals make a meaningful contribution to the welfare of others. The book provides a comprehensive examination of the role of the State, with proponents arguing that ethical ends and the well-being of citizens should be central to all policy and legislation. It also provides a detailed overview of the social landscape, including housing, pensions, the treatment of criminals, and factory conditions. In-depth consideration is given to the vital importance of individual action, with the authors emphasizing the need for religious and ethical teachings to inform our motives and guide our civic responsibilities. A recurring theme is the necessity of balancing personal conscience with obedience to the law, recognizing that the State's authority ultimately stems from the consent of its citizens.
